LinuxTec
(usa Debian)
Enviado em 04/11/2011 - 14:39h
Boa tarde,
chamou minha atenção seu problema, pois acredito que esse problema é o mesmo de muitos que monta um servidor web.
acredito que o seu servidor seja o apache certo.
o que acontece é o seguinte, a configuração default do apache é a seguinte entre em
cd /etc/apache2/sites-enabled#
vim 000-default
1 <VirtualHost *:80>
2 ServerAdmin webmaster@localhost
3
4 DocumentRoot /var/www << ============== diretorio que vai responder
5 <Directory />
6 Options FollowSymLinks
7 AllowOverride None
8 </Directory>
9 <Directory /var/www/> << ============== diretorio que vai responder
10 Options Indexes FollowSymLinks MultiViews
11 AllowOverride None
12 Order allow,deny
13 allow from all
14 </Directory>
15
16 ScriptAlias /cgi-bin/ /usr/lib/cgi-bin/
17 <Directory "/usr/lib/cgi-bin">
18 AllowOverride None
19 Options +ExecCGI -MultiViews +SymLinksIfOwnerMatch
20 Order allow,deny
21 Allow from all
22 </Directory>
23
24 ErrorLog ${APACHE_LOG_DIR}/error.log
25
26 # Possible values include: debug, info, notice, warn, error, crit,
27 # alert, emerg.
28 LogLevel warn
29
30 CustomLog ${APACHE_LOG_DIR}/access.log combined
31
32 Alias /doc/ "/usr/share/doc/"
33 <Directory "/usr/share/doc/">
34 Options Indexes MultiViews FollowSymLinks
35 AllowOverride None
36 Order deny,allow
37 Deny from all
38 Allow from 127.0.0.0/255.0.0.0 ::1/128
39 </Directory>
40
41 </VirtualHost>
Portanto, para trabalharmos com multiplos dominios, teremos que ter para cada dominio criado um novo dominio virtual que vai responder para seu diretório entendeu, então o que você precisa é criar dominios virtuais para cada novo dominio criado no apache.
Isso é muito simples amigo, da uma analisada nessa dica aqui do nosso companheiro, espero poder ter tirado sua dúvida, não esqueça de marcar como resolvido a sua dúvida.
http://www.vivaolinux.com.br/artigo/Virtual-Host-com-Apache/